New Materialisms in Music and Sound (UT-Austin Grad. Student Conference): April 17-18, 2021
Keynote Speaker: Ana María Ochoa Gautier
Artist in Residence: Tanya Kalmanovitch
Guest Performer: João Renato Orecchia Zúñiga
Deadline for presentation submissions: extended to March 15, 2021
Inspired by “new materialist” interventions, we invite you to critically bring music and sound back to the realm of things. We especially welcome presentations with a clear emphasis on expanding and putting pressure on the Western-centric topics and epistemologies that model much academic thought. Potential lines of inquiry include, but are not limited to:
Physical ways of apprehending music and sound; Considerations on Marxist historical materialism; Music and sound as a material tool for regulating human and non-human bodies; Music, sound and space; Music and material livelihoods.
